SLOT MAKES ROBERTSON CLAIM
Reds boss Arne Slot has opened up and revealed that he fully expects shock Tottenham target Andy Robertson to stay at Liverpool during this January transfer window.
Since joining from Hull City for a bargain £8m in 2017, the Scot has been virtually undroppable, amassing over 360 appearances for LIVERPOOL. However, the current campaign has painted a different picture.
The LIVERPOOL ‘ vice-captain has rotated at left-back for the majority of the season with £40m summer signing Milos Kerkez and the Scotland captain faces the toughest competition he’s had for a place in the side since he broke into the team.
Robertson has recently publicly opened the door to a potential exit this summer, acknowledging that his lack of game time is a major factor as he approaches the end of his contract in the summer, and that opened the door for Tottenham to make a move this January.
Tottenham have been linked with alot of players over the course of the transfer window, but so far, boss Tomas Frank has not got the players that he would have liked, and it seems that he will also not be getting Robertson.
Speaking about the Scotland defender before the game against Newcastle, Slot said: “Robbo is part of the team tomorrow evening and he has been apart of this squad for many years. Happy to have him, it’s good that he’s available because that’s quite important for us at the moment, to have players available.
Nothing happened my side. It’s hard to say anything definite with the world we live in [whether he stays this month] but I expect him to say, yes.”

LIVERPOOL MAKE DUMFRIES CONTACT
There has been some shock reports in the media which have claimed that Liverpool have made an approach to Inter Milan for right-back Denzel Dumfries, as Arne SAlot looks to solve his right-back issue.
LIVERPOOL looked like such an impressive side last season and played the kind of football that many to teams love, which led to them pushing on and winning that Premier League in Arne Slots first season with the club.
But this season they have not looked like the side that dominated last season, with poor performances from the clubs big names, and alot of injuries causing Arne Slot to start worrying for his job in the long run.
But the injury to Jeremie Frimpong and Conor Bradley has caused even more concerns for the Dutch boss and there has been some speculation in the media that he would like the board to delve into that transfer kitty and bring in some cover to help ease the pain
WHAT IS THE LATEST?
Because of the injuries Liverpool have picked up, Sky Italia has come out and reported that LIVERPOOL have now made their moves to try and get a very late deal done for Inter Milan star Dumfries.
Dumfries is regarded as one of the best attacking right-backs in Europe and a player that all the big clubs have been looking at, but despite interest from Liverpool this time, the Dutchman has been managing an injury, with an ankle problem causing him issues since November, and may not be open to a move away this January.
